Evolution of Slot Games: From Mechanical Reels to Interactive Experiences

Since their inception in the late 19th century, slot machines have been a staple of entertainment and gambling. Initially mechanical, their evolution into digital formats marked a significant turning point, making games more accessible and diverse. Today, the industry is witnessing a further transformation driven by gamification principles, blending slot mechanics with narrative elements, mini-games, and social features. This shift underpins a move from passive spinning to active engagement, encouraging longer session times and higher player retention.

The Rise of Mobile-First Interactive Slots

With over 60% of global internet traffic originating from mobile devices as of 2023, developers are prioritizing mobile-compatible designs that maximize engagement. Interactive slots now incorporate features such as story modes, skill-based challenges, and community leaderboards, making gameplay more dynamic and personalized. These innovations are not merely cosmetic; they tap into users’ desire for immersive experiences reminiscent of mainstream gaming titles.

An intriguing aspect of this trend is how it intersects with the broader rise of gamified content across various entertainment sectors. For instance, game developers are borrowing concepts from popular titles like Fortnite and Clash Royale, integrating competitive elements and achievement systems into slots—thus elevating the traditional format into a digital playground.

Underlying Technologies and Future Outlook

Advances in HTML5, augmented reality (AR), and machine learning have facilitated the development of richer, more responsive slot games. Developers now experiment with features like augmented reality overlays and personalized reward algorithms that adapt to user behavior, making each session unique and compelling.

Looking ahead, industry experts anticipate that the boundary between casual gaming and gambling will continue blurring, driven by innovations such as blockchain-based incentives and social betting platforms. This evolution presents opportunities for regulators and operators to craft responsible, engaging experiences that attract a broader demographic while ensuring consumer protection.
